行业资讯 使用Laravel构建社交媒体营销平台

使用Laravel构建社交媒体营销平台

31
 

在当今数字化时代,社交媒体营销成为了企业推广和品牌建设的重要手段。而Laravel作为一种流行的PHP框架,为开发者提供了丰富的功能和工具,使得构建一个高效、可靠的社交媒体营销平台变得更加简单和便捷。本文将介绍如何使用Laravel构建一个功能强大的社交媒体营销平台。

首先,我们需要设计和建立适当的数据库结构。Laravel提供了强大的数据库工具和ORM(对象关系映射)功能,使得数据库的管理变得简单和直观。通过定义用户、帖子、评论和关注等数据模型,我们可以建立一个具有良好关系的数据库结构,用于存储和检索社交媒体营销平台的数据。

接下来,通过Laravel的路由和控制器来处理与社交媒体营销平台相关的请求和响应。我们可以定义特定的路由来显示用户的个人资料、帖子列表、发布帖子等功能。控制器负责处理这些路由的请求,进行相应的数据操作和逻辑处理。Laravel的路由和控制器提供了一种简单而灵活的方式来构建社交媒体营销平台的功能。

在社交媒体营销平台中,用户之间的关注和互动是非常重要的。通过利用Laravel的事件和广播系统,我们可以实现实时的用户关注和帖子互动功能。通过定义相应的事件和广播,我们可以实时推送关注信息和帖子互动通知给相关的用户。这样,用户可以实时了解关注者的动态和帖子的互动,增加社交媒体营销的效果和用户参与度。

此外,Laravel的视图和Blade模板引擎可以帮助我们构建美观而高度定制的用户界面。通过使用Laravel的视图组件、布局和部分视图,我们可以轻松地构建出社交媒体营销平台的各种页面和元素。Blade模板引擎提供了丰富的语法和功能,使得模板的编写和渲染变得简单而灵活。

在社交媒体营销平台中,数据的分析和统计是评估营销效果和优化策略的关键。Laravel的查询构建器和Eloquent ORM可以帮助我们进行数据分析和统计。通过使用Laravel的查询构建器,我们可以编写灵活的查询语句,根据不同的指标和条件获取相关的数据。同时,Laravel的Eloquent ORM提供了方便的模型方法,使得数据的分析和统计变得更加简单和直观。

最后,通过Laravel的认证和授权系统,我们可以管理用户的注册、登录和权限控制。Laravel提供了内置的用户认证功能,我们可以轻松地实现用户注册和登录的功能。通过定义适当的用户角色和权限,我们可以限制用户对社交媒体营销平台的操作和访问,确保平台的安全性和可控性。

综上所述,使用Laravel构建社交媒体营销平台为企业提供了一个强大的工具和平台。通过充分利用Laravel的功能和工具,我们能够构建一个高效、安全和用户友好的社交媒体营销平台。无论是用户互动、数据分析还是个性化的营销策略,Laravel与社交媒体营销平台的构建使我们能够实现高效的社交媒体营销,推动品牌的建设和用户参与度的提升。

更新:2024-11-10 00:00:11 © 著作权归作者所有
QQ
微信